James Webb Space Telescope (JWST) Optical Telescope Element (OTE) Pathfinder status and plans

Lee D. Feinberg, Ritva Keski-Kuha, Charlie Atkinson, Andrew J. Booth, Tony Whitman

Open publisher page 4 citations

Abstract

A JWST OTE Pathfinder telescope that includes two spare primary mirror segments, a spare secondary mirror, and a large composite structure with a deployed secondary support structure is in the assembly stage and will be fully completed this year. This Pathfinder will check out key steps in the ambient mirror integration process and also be used at the Johnson Space Center (JSC) to check out the optical Ground Support Equipment (GSE) and associated procedures that will be used to test the full JWST telescope and instruments at JSC. This paper will summarize the Pathfinder integration and testing flow, the critical Ground Support Equipment it will test and the key tests planned with the Pathfinder.
